rectangular box
A particle is confined to be within a rectangular box of dimensions 1 cm by 1 cm by 2 cm. Furthermore, the magnitude of its momentum is constrained to be less than 3 × 10−24 kg m/s.

(a) What is the probability that it is in any one particular quantum state?
(b) What is the probability that the magnitude of its momentum is less than 2 × 10−24 kg m/s?
(c) What is the probability that the magnitude of its momentum is greater than 10−24 kg m/s and less than 3 × 10−24 kg m/s and that it is in the right-hand half of the box?
